钡铼案例 污水处理远程监控系统的应用介绍

背景

这几年以来,随着国家对环保方面的重视,各地纷纷建立了自己的污水处理站。如何才能保护水资源让其循环利用达到节能减排,是目前急需解决的,正是污水处理项目对水资源的改善以及人民生活水平的提高有着重大的意义。

污水处理是一个复杂的过程,需要经过多个步骤和使用各种设备来处理污水,以保证其达到排放标准。这个过程中需要对各种设备进行监控和管理,以确保其正常运行,同时保护工人免受污染物、病原体或有害化学物质的伤害。

然而,传统的工业控制系统通常采用专用的硬件、软件和通信协议,这些系统之间难以实现互联互通,这给污水处理过程的自动化监控和管理带来了困难。因此,随着工业数字化发展,物联网、数字化逐渐联系越来越紧密,人们开始将这些技术应用到工业控制领域,以实现设备的互联互通和智能化管理。

钡铼一直国内外污水处理项目中数产品的重要供应商,由于客户站点中的设备数量和种类多,支持的通讯协议也各不相同,为了采集设备的数据,钡铼最新研发的产品采用“多转一”或“多转多”的方式,支持OPC UAMQTT、MODBUS等协议,这有助于实现项目数字化,智能化,而且降低物联网系统建设的工程和维护成本,并增强从现场到云端的数据安全性。

什么是OPC UA?

OPC是工业自动化领域的开放标准,基于微软的OLE、COM和DCOM技术,旨在消除自动化软件和硬件平台之间的互操作障碍。然而,OPC依赖于Windows系统,存在跨平台使用限制,需要复杂的DCOM配置,且通讯稳定性、安全性和远距离通讯能力有待提高。为了解决这些问题,OPC基金会开发了新一代OPC技术——OPC UA,实现了不同系统和不同协议设备之间的相互通信。因此,为了方便区分,上一代OPC技术称为OPC Classic,新一代的称为OPC UA。

OPC UA基于OPC基金会提供的新一代技术,提供安全,可靠和独立于厂商的,实现原始数据和预处理的信息从制造层级到生产计划或ERP层级的传输。通过OPC UA,所有需要的信息在任何时间,任何地点对每个授权的应用,每个授权的人员都可用。这种功能独立于制造厂商的原始应用,编程语言和操作系统。OPC UA采用互联网标准使用的安全技术,满足了完整性、机密性、可用性等三大安全需求。实现了使用数字签名的数据确认和严密的消息加密,使FA与IT安全互连。

需求

在污水处理厂实施远程监控环境和设备运行的系统必须面临环境挑战,因为污水处理厂的许多处理单元位于广阔的室外,这给部署数据采集和传输带来了困难。所以,不仅需要无线远程控制功能,同时还应具有信号强、覆盖广的特点,以保证数据传输的可靠性。最关键的端到云部分,该公司希望用最少的硬件来收集和上传水泵站数据配置。同时,控制单元和其他设备可能使用不同的通信协议,需要统一,以简化数据共享。

还有,由于系统柜内的空间有限,产品必须紧凑且易于安装,并在泵站的恶劣环境中提供必要的设备保护。

为了这个难题,钡铼为污水处理站提供一个污水处理站控制系统解决方案,中央控制室的工控设备为工控机,现场站分散部署大量PLC和支持OPC UA的分布式I/O模块。

系统组成

  1. 钡铼支持OPC UA的分布式I/O模块BL206pro
  2. PLC
  3. 钡铼边缘计算工控机BL304

总体框架由工控机与PLC来对系统进行自动化的控制。PLC的可靠性与稳定性都是十分高的,而且它的抗干扰能力比较强,能很好地满足现场控制的需求,只是缺少一个数据分析处理的大脑;如果是工控机来控制,虽然有了方便性与灵活性,但是又没有了PLC的优点。将两者有机结合起来,可以做到优势互补。

这个系统的结构是上、下位机主从式的,各部分的功能分别是:

下位机:主控PLC,它与分布式I/O模块连接,I/O模块通过I/O口来采集现场污水处理设备的数据,来实现本地报警、状态判定与分站控制的功能。也就是说采用BL206Pro做PLC的扩展I/O模块,具有很好的通用性集成到各自的远程站点。

上位机:采用工控机,与PLC完美协同,将各个远程站点的数据(包括流量、水质、溶解氧、液位等)显示在平台上面,可满足实时显示现场设备运行状态并且远程点控设备,方便现场人员整体操控;功能包括状态显示、故障记录、时间日期、负荷记录、系统设置、参数设置、模式选择、报表统计以及实时数据显示等。此外,上位机连接着HMI、打印机等输入输出设备,有十分友好直观的操作界面。

下图是我们一个用户的实际应用案例系统框架图

系统优势

实时监测

工作人员实时在线了解污水处理站现场的设备运行状态、仪器仪表检测数据等重要参数,然后根据屏幕上显示的异常情况做出应对调整.

设备控制

通过实时控制可以实现水质监测,泵机打开等操作,即使用户不在现场也可以远程操控设备。

报警监测

如果设备出现故障,工控机会按照事先制定的预案启动故障报警功能并对故障进行初次处理,主要采用显示报警声音、画面方式提示污水处理站工作人员对故障进行处理。用户可以提前设备好设备报警和关闭的条件,达到设定的限度时,就会通过短信、APP、微信等方式通知用户及时进行处理。报警&事件显示,包括液位限制警告、添加剂警告、电机故障、温度报警、通讯故障等。

数据分析

工控机支持各个监测系统数据历史和报警历史和报警记录的储存,用户可以自己搜索某一时间段的异常,查看原因。

视频监控功能

工控机支持视频监控功能,支持海康威视等摄像头接入,并在手机端、电脑端随时随地查看现场情况。

定制化服务

如果现有功能无法满足你的需求,钡铼技术可以针对用户的需求提供定制化服务。

系统的效益

①可以使得不同地方的资源得到充分的利用,减少出差的次数。异地的专家可以直接通过云平台获得监控的数据,分析处理,进行远程调试。

②远程监控系统数据采集,可以实现数据实时采集,获得现场实时数据进行监控,可以为后续的维修提供数据保障。

③管理人员使用远程监控系统,不用自己到恶劣的环境现场进行监控,可以远程对数据进行设备调控,修复故障。

总结

钡铼污水处理站产品不仅对于设备及运行数据可以精准、实时采集,同时支持断点续传保证稳定、高效通讯,通过远程系统状态监测,可对处理站海量数据进行远程监测与分析,并通过工控机在线查看站点监控动态画面,及时掌握现场设备的运行状态&实时调度管理,真正展示了如何借助物联网技术监测分散的孤岛式处理站信息并将其上传云端,通过预防性保养和维护,做到防患于未然,省时、省力降本增效。

钡铼技术可根据用户需求,制定核心元器件品牌。如果大家还对钡铼产品有什么问题,或者配备的产品有什么问题可以拨打,我们将8小时内给您提供解决方案。

钡铼技术提供各种工业物联网解决方案。支持私有化定制部署。研发多种物联网硬件产品,用户可自行选择硬件接入,拥有更多自主权。

本期产品介绍

钡铼工控机

强烈推荐——BL304

• 最高可提供4路RS485/RS232,1路CAN口,2路网口,2路DI口,2路PWM口输出以及2路USB 接口,1路电源输入接口、1路HDMI视频显示接口。

• 支持多种工业通信协议Modbus、MQTT、OPC UA、Profinet、EtherCAT、Ethernet/IP、BACnet/IP等; 

• 可运行Linux、Ubuntu、Debian、Android等OS,兼容Node-Red、QT、Python、C++等应用程序,支持MySQL、InfluxDB、SQLite等数据库。

•小巧的尺寸,DIN35导轨安装,让嵌入式ARM控制器BL304具有广泛的应用场景。

• 可支持4G/有线/无线上网功能;

• 支持芯片过热保护,过热自动降频或重启;

钡铼分布式I/O模块

强烈推荐——BL200

• 最大可接入32个 I/O 模块;

• 支持多种工业通信协议Modbus、MQTT、OPC UA、Profinet、EtherCAT、Ethernet/IP、BACnet/IP等; 

• 支持接入阿里云、华为云、AWS云、Thingsboard、Ignition等;

• 内置可编程逻辑控制、边缘计算;

• 现场侧和系统侧以及总线侧三者彼此电气隔离;

• 支持2 x RJ45接口,集成交换机功能,可以建立线路拓扑,节约交换机或集线器;

插拔式设计,让接线变得更容易,并可方便地插接。分散式的结构设计更符合人机工程学,使其操作更容易。该系统的所有部件都是机械稳定的,适用于比较恶劣的工业环境,并具有IP20防护等级,用于可靠的电气连接。

通过以太网连接的菊花链拓扑,以便于安装减少对额外交换机的需求。无需协议网关,从而最大限度地降低部署和维护成本。还具有无与伦比的数据安全性,包括 OPC UA 标准提供的加密和证书登录。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mfbz.cn/a/285867.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

AC——对HTTPS数据进行行为审计时的解密方式

目录 SSL中间人解密 客户端代理解密(准入插件解密) 深信服的AC提供两种SSL解密技术用于对https行为进行解密 中间人解密和准入插件解密 SSL中间人解密 解密工作原理 当内网PC端发起SSL连接请求的时候,AC会以代理服务器的身份&#xff0…

vba抓取网页数据

哈喽,哈喽,大家好!大家2024发大财啦! 不知道,平时大家爱不爱看电影呢?从今年的贺岁档的拍片来看,今年的电影还挺多,而且国产优秀电影居多,元旦假期期间我也去看了部喜剧…

【数据库原理】(4)数据模型介绍

在数据库中,数据不仅包含数据本身的内容,还包括数据之间的关系。这是因为计算机无法直接处理现实世界中的具体事物,因此必须将这些事物抽象成数据模型,以便计算机处理。 数据处理的三个领域 数据从现实世界到数据库里的具体表示…

【C++学习】:命名空间、输入输出和缺省参数全面解析

🎥 屿小夏 : 个人主页 🔥个人专栏 : C入门到进阶 🌄 莫道桑榆晚,为霞尚满天! 文章目录 📑前言一. 命名空间1.1 为什么需要命名空间?1.2 命名空间的定义1.3 命名空间特性1…

3个值得推荐的WPF UI组件库

WPF介绍 WPF 是一个强大的桌面应用程序框架,用于构建具有丰富用户界面的 Windows 应用。它提供了灵活的布局、数据绑定、样式和模板、动画效果等功能,让开发者可以创建出吸引人且交互性强的应用程序。 HandyControl HandyControl是一套WPF控件库&…

图像分割实战-系列教程9:U2NET显著性检测实战1

🍁🍁🍁图像分割实战-系列教程 总目录 有任何问题欢迎在下面留言 本篇文章的代码运行界面均在Pycharm中进行 本篇文章配套的代码资源已经上传 U2NET显著性检测实战1 1、任务概述

如何本地快速部署Apache服务器并使用内网穿透工具实现公网访问内网服务

文章目录 前言1.Apache服务安装配置1.1 进入官网下载安装包1.2 Apache服务配置 2.安装cpolar内网穿透2.1 注册cpolar账号2.2 下载cpolar客户端 3. 获取远程桌面公网地址3.1 登录cpolar web ui管理界面3.2 创建公网地址 4. 固定公网地址 前言 Apache作为全球使用较高的Web服务器…

深度学习|2.4 梯度下降

如上图, J ( w , b ) J(w,b) J(w,b)是由w和b两个参数共同控制的损失函数,损失是不好的东西,所以应该求取合适的w和b使得损失最小化。 为了简单考虑,可以先忽略参数b。 斜率可以理解成在朝着x正方向移动单位距离所形成的损失值的变…

【Linux驱动】设备树模型的LED驱动 | 查询方式的按键驱动

🐱作者:一只大喵咪1201 🐱专栏:《Linux驱动》 🔥格言:你只管努力,剩下的交给时间! 目录 🍮设备树模型的LED驱动🍩设备树文件🍩驱动程序 &#x1…

【数据结构】树的遍历

树的遍历 前序遍历 前序遍历是按照根节点->左子树->右子树的顺序进行遍历 图片来源维基百科深度优先遍历(前序遍历): F, B, A, D, C, E, G, I, H. 代码实现 递归 # class TreeNode: # def __init__(self, x): # self.val x # …

[笔记] GICv3/v4 ITS 与 LPI

0. 写在前面 由于移植一个 pcie 设备驱动时,需要处理该 pcie 设备的 msi 中断(message signaled interrup)。 在 ARM 中, ARM 建议 msi 中断实现方式为: pcie 设备往 cpu 的一段特殊内存(寄存器)写某一个值&#xff0…

浅析xxl-obj分布式任务调度平台RCE漏洞

文章目录 前言本地环境搭建1、初始化数据库2、搭建调度中心3、搭建出执行器 XXL-JOB漏洞1、后台弱口令->RCE2、未授权API->RCE3、默认accessToken4、CVE-2022-361575、SSRF漏洞->RCE 总结 前言 在日常开发中,经常会用定时任务执行某些不紧急又非常重要的事…

c# 捕获全部线程的异常 试验

1.概要 捕获全部线程的异常 试验,最终结果task的异常没有找到捕获方法 2.代码 2.1.试验1 2.1.1 试验结果 2.2 代码 2.2.1主程序代码 using NLog; using System; using System.Threading; using System.Windows.Forms;namespace 异常监控 {static class Program…

【C#】知识点实践序列之Lock简单解决并发引起数据重复问题

欢迎来到《小5讲堂之知识点实践序列》文章,大家好,我是全栈小5。 这是2023年第3篇文章,此篇文章是C#知识点实践序列文章,博主能力有限,理解水平有限,若有不对之处望指正! 本篇在Lock锁定代码块基…

主浏览器优化之路2——Edge浏览器的卸载与旧版本的重新安装

Edge浏览器的卸载与旧版本的重新安装 引言开整寻找最年轻的她开始卸载原本的Edge工具下载后新版本的安装 结尾 引言 (这个前奏有点长,但是其中有一些我的思考顿悟与标题的由来,望耐心) 我在思考这个系列的时候 最让我陷入困得是…

python 深度学习 记录遇到的报错问题10

本篇继python 深度学习 解决遇到的报错问题9_module d2l.torch has no attribute train_ch3-CSDN博客 一、CUDA error: no kernel image is available for execution on the device CUDA kernel errors might be asynchronously reported at some other API call,so the stackt…

架构设计的核心:从多个维度理论分析

文章目录 一、如何实现高内聚低耦合的架构1、确定边界2、内聚的分类3、耦合的分类4、如何实现高内聚低耦合(1)耦合关注点(2)低耦合原则(3)高内聚原则 二、如何实现可扩展性的架构1、扩展性:核心…

机器人活动区域 - 华为OD统一考试

OD统一考试 题解: Java / Python / C++ 题目描述 现有一个机器人,可放置于 M x N 的网格中任意位置,每个网格包含一个非负整数编号,当相邻网格的数字编号差值的绝对值小于等于 1 时机器人可以在网格间移动。 问题: 求机器人可活动的最大范围对应的网格点数目。 说明: 网格…

G-LAB|2024年1月份最新的开班计划

1🈷最新的开班计划 👇👇👇 思科华为HCIA、HCIP、红帽RHCE 可预约免费试听

C#/.NET/.NET Core推荐学习书籍(23年12月更新)

前言 古人云:“书中自有黄金屋,书中自有颜如玉”,说明了书籍的重要性。作为程序员,我们需要不断学习以提升自己的核心竞争力。以下是一些优秀的C#/.NET/.NET Core相关学习书籍,值得.NET开发者们学习和专研。书籍已分类…
最新文章